Snails are gastropods, a class of mollusks that includes slugs, snails, and sea hares. Their slow movement is primarily due to their unique anatomy. Snails have a muscular foot that propels them forward, but this foot is not very powerful. The foot is made up of tiny muscles that contract and relax, allowing the snail to push against surfaces and move. However, this system is not as efficient as the more powerful limbs found in other animals, such as insects or mammals.
